Hypokalemia potentiated the arryhthmogenic effects of digoxin and promoted inhibition of cardiac Na+,K+-ATPase. Acute hypokalemia did not modify digoxin-induced inotropy and therefore altered the quantitative relationship between inhibition of Na+,K+-ATPase and positive inotropy. Chronic hypokalemia impaired the positive inotropic response to digoxin and to isoproterenol in the absence of an electron microscopically detectable cardiomyopathy.
